Princess Mononoke Tribute
For this entry, I captured five key moments from Princess Mononoke (1997). Each scene has its own decorative base, but the separate pieces can be arranged in a variety of ways to create unique displays--the four smaller builds slot perfectly under the edges of the central build!
Included in this set:
- A large, brick-built model of the deer god standing on the lake's surface. The deer god is depicted mid-transformation to capture some of the magic of the animation, and comes with two swappable heads.
- Part of the forest itself, with kodama and butterflies amongst the greenery.
- The entrance to Iron Town, with a watch tower and working gate.
- Monk Jigo's campfire.
- A forest cave--the wolf Moro lies on top, while the build can be opened to reveal the cave within.
- Minifigures of Ashitaka, San, Lady Eboshi, Monk Jigo, Toki, and a samurai; brick-built figures of Yakul, Moro, the deer god, and numerous kodama.
